Have you ever tried looking through a paper towel roll or a straw? That’s what tunnel vision can feel like. It’s a type of peripheral vision loss that narrows your field of view, making it hard—or sometimes impossible—to see anything that isn’t directly in front of you. March is Workplace Eye Wellness Month, a time to raise awareness about protecting your eyes on the job. According to the National Institute for Occupational Safety and Health (NIOSH), about 2,000 U.S. workers suffer job-related eye injuries that need medical treatment every day. Researchers have found that lutein, zeaxanthin, vitamin C, vitamin E, and zinc can help protect your eyes and lower the risk of age-related macular degeneration and cataracts.
